Jacy is a vulnerable women, who has came to Rockwood Beach a few years back, to start over, to heal. She runs a sweet little coffee shop, enjoys the company of her best friend Rachel, and her loving dog Rex. Simple and quiet is what surrounds her days. But with the appearance of her new rugged, tattooed neighbor, Jacy finds him awakening feelings in her she thought where long gone. With the help of Ledger, Jacy is hoping to get a redo, to have some fun and experience small things, in a positive way. In a way that is not haunted by her past and bad memories. 

Ledger has come to this small beach town to also start over, the last few years of his life where hard. His whole life, he's been in and out of trouble. making bad decisions. He's ready for a new start, a job, school. And his run down little beach house is just what he needs. Ledger is drawn to his beautiful neighbor, with her big heart and sad eyes. But his reason for coming to this town may not all be what they seem. He's hiding a secret form Jacy, that could ruin his chances with her. 

Tess has once again brought us a wonderful story, its emotional and raw, sweet yet sad. With such gripping characters. Jacy & Ledger are just two people looking to start over. To find themselves, make amends, learn to heal and live life again. 

Beautiful characters, a heart-aching & touching story line, and fantastic writing.
